  • Brewery Technician - Cisco Brewers

    Cisco Brewers is looking for a 3rd Shift Brewery Technician to join our team in Portsmouth, NH! Reporting to the Senior Manager of Brewing Operations, our Brewery Technicians are responsible for crafting, brewing, and packaging high-quality products.


    Specific Job Duties:
    • Supports the Company’s mission, vision and values.
    • Performs duties in accordance with company safety policies and procedures.
    • Maintains attendance and punctuality per company policy.
    • Supports the safeguarding of raw materials for quality assurance and for accurate inventory.
    • Monitors progress of beer through the production cycle via brewery information system.
    • Works with team members throughout the brewing, racking ,packaging and warehousing process.
    • Operates high-speed packaging equipment – racking, canning and bottling
    • Handles empty cases and cases with finished goods
    • Assists in loading and unloading trucks; drive forklift as needed.
    • Properly rotates product by date to ensure freshness to customers.
    • Stages keg, bottle and can orders.
    • Assists brewery Leads/Manager(s) with inventory reconciliation.
    • Performs equipment maintenance.
    • Performs required sanitation.
    • Performs regular housekeeping for all brewery areas.
    • Performs and maintains accurate inventory and record keeping daily.
    • Performs other duties as assigned throughout the brewery to assist other team members as needed to accomplish goals.
    • Provide assistance in other areas in the absence of another team member
    • Perform other related duties as assigned

    Position Requirements:
    • Bachelor’s Degree or coursework in a science discipline, or equivalent experience in a General Certificate or Diploma in Brewing from the Institute of Brewing and Distilling, or similar institution is preferred but not required.
    • 1-2 years of brewing industry, packaging line, and forklift experience preferred but not required.
    • Familiarity with and passion for brewing, fermenting and the finishing stage of beer production.
    • Attention to detail and patience for brewing process to achieve high standards of quality.
    • Mechanical or electrical troubleshooting experience.
    A willingness to contribute to all areas of the brewery as needed with a positive attitude.
